” The dimension of directional diffusers in the SI device is 595x595mm. If you put an Imperial unit directional diffuser (603x603mm) on a SI device ceiling, it will never in good shape. The identical applies to other squareshaped ceiling diffusers. Typical directional diffusers are made of aluminium. Galvanized steel directional diffusers are likely to rust. Directional diffusers can what is ductwork in hvac be found Pretty much all over the place, especially in Business structures and browsing malls. Notably, the two×2 ft four-way diffuser is the most typical type of HVAC diffuser.

The diameter of round diffusers is offered from 150mm around 600mm or more based on the manufacturer. Having said that, most round diffusers are 250mm and 300mm in diameter because these dimensions are appropriate for about 250-three hundred cfm of airflow.
